Esther L. Walter serves 490 students in grades Kindergarten-6.
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 46% (which is higher than the California state average of 40%) for the 2018-19 school year. The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 48% (which is lower than the California state average of 51%) for the 2018-19 school year.
The student:teacher ratio of 20:1 is lower than the California state level of 21:1.
Minority enrollment is 94%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the California state average of 79% (majority Hispanic).

Esther L. Walter's student population of 490 students has declined by 21% over five school years.
The teacher population of 24 teachers has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
